Question

To ask the Secretary of State for Business, Innovation and Skills, which investment bank or banks his Department has had discussions with on the proposed privatisation of the Green Investment Bank.

This question was answered on 6th July 2015

My Department is receiving financial advice on the proposed transaction from Bank of America Merrill Lynch (BAML) and Herbert Smith Freehills are providing legal advice. UK Green Investment Bank plc (GIB) is separately receiving its own financial advice from UBS and legal advice from Slaughter & May.

The detail of discussions with potential investors is commercially confidential but I can confirm that GIB, UBS and BAML have had initial discussions with a number of institutional investors to test the likely level of interest in acquiring a stake in GIB. As a result, we believe the time is now right to explore the scope for a sale. We will only proceed with a transaction if satisfied it delivers value for money to the taxpayer.
